Soho Screening Rooms

London, England, United Kingdom ● Screening Room

Company: Soho Screening Rooms

Address: 14 D'Arblay St, Soho, London W1F 8DY, England

Website:

Phone: +44-2074371771

Email: enquiries@sohoscreeningrooms.co.uk

Theatre Rating
Based on 0 users